HC Deb 22 June 1989 vol 155 c257W
Mr. Wilson

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ence what has been the(a) average and (b) peak total number of aircraft held in storage at RAF St. Athan in each year since 1980.

Mr. Neubert

RAF St. Athan is a major maintenance depot and is used routinely for storing attrition aircraft and aircraft awaiting servicing. Records of the number of aircraft held in storage are not kept in the form requested. However, it is estimated that, on average, about 50 aircraft of various types and ages are held at RAF St. Athan.
